Digital Transformation Success Requires Digital Assurance

Digital transformation has become a ubiquitous term across industries, promising modernization and efficiency. However, the path to successful digital overhaul is fraught with risk – over half of these projects stumble due to inadequate preparation. Increasingly, businesses are recognizing that digital assurance isn’t just a beneficial add-on, but a critical partner to navigate this complex landscape.
Digital assurance represents a shift from traditional, end-stage software testing to a holistic, continuous quality control process. It’s not simply about finding bugs; it’s about proactively ensuring software meets both industry standards and user expectations throughout the entire development lifecycle, from initial planning to final deployment. This allows for incremental upgrades, carefully monitored to prevent errors and disruptions.
The core benefit lies in its preventative nature. While digital transformation focuses on what changes are being made, digital assurance focuses on how those changes are implemented, minimizing risk and maximizing the potential for success. It’s a comprehensive approach that leverages diverse methodologies and modern tools to thoroughly evaluate software at every stage.
Specifically, digital assurance strengthens security, a crucial consideration as digitalization inherently increases vulnerability to cyberattacks. It also optimizes workflows by proactively identifying and mitigating potential disruptions, leading to faster, more efficient transformations.
Beyond technical improvements, digital assurance fosters organizational clarity. By clearly defining roles and responsibilities, it boosts team efficiency and productivity. This focus on user needs translates directly into improved user experience, increased market demand, and ultimately, stronger business outcomes. The ability to accelerate updates without sacrificing quality is a significant advantage in today’s fast-paced digital environment.
